The Philippine Department of Foreign Affairs (DFA) opened appointments this week for new passports with a 10-year validity period, which will be issued starting January 1.
Previously, passports were only valid for five years.
According to a report in Inquirer.net, both new passports and renewed passports issued by next month will have the 10-year expiration date.
Passport fees are as follows:
PHP950.00 (US$19) for regular processing (20 working days)
PHP1,200.00 (US$50) for express processing (10 working days)
